在使用GitHub进行项目管理时,可能会遇到需要删除仓库的情况。无论是因为项目不再需要,还是由于项目的重组,了解如何删除GitHub中的仓库都是一项重要的技能。在本文中,我们将为您提供一份全面的指南,帮助您安全有效地删除GitHub中的仓库。
什么是GitHub仓库?
在开始之前,我们先来了解一下什么是GitHub仓库。GitHub仓库是一个用于存储项目文件和代码的地方,开发者可以在其中进行版本控制、协作和管理项目。每个仓库可以包含多个分支、提交记录、问题跟踪等功能。
为什么要删除GitHub仓库?
删除GitHub仓库可能出于以下几种原因:
- 项目不再需要:如果一个项目已经完成或不再活跃,可以选择删除。
- 安全原因:如果仓库中存有敏感信息,及时删除是保护数据安全的关键。
- 清理空间:为了保持GitHub帐户的整洁,清理不必要的仓库也是一种良好的习惯。
删除GitHub仓库的步骤
删除GitHub中的仓库并不是一件复杂的事情,但需要小心操作。以下是具体的步骤:
1. 登录到GitHub账户
- 打开浏览器,访问GitHub官网。
- 输入您的用户名和密码,登录到您的帐户。
2. 找到要删除的仓库
- 登录后,点击右上角的头像,选择“Your repositories”(您的仓库)。
- 在仓库列表中找到您要删除的仓库。
3. 进入仓库设置
- 点击仓库名称,进入仓库页面。
- 在页面右侧找到“Settings”(设置)选项,点击进入。
4. 滚动到页面底部
- 在设置页面向下滚动,找到“Danger Zone”(危险区域)。
5. 删除仓库
- 在“Danger Zone”中,您会看到“Delete this repository”(删除此仓库)选项。
- 点击该选项,GitHub会要求您确认删除。
- 系统会提示您输入仓库名称以确认删除,确保输入正确。
- 点击“我理解后果,删除此仓库”(I understand the consequences, delete this repository)进行确认。
6. 完成删除
- 如果操作成功,系统会显示相应的提示,您的仓库将被永久删除。
注意事项
- 无法恢复:删除仓库是不可逆的,一旦删除,所有文件、提交记录和问题都将永久消失,请在删除之前确保备份必要数据。
- 权限:确保您有权限删除该仓库,尤其是当仓库属于团队或组织时,可能需要特定的权限才能执行此操作。
FAQ:常见问题解答
Q1: 删除GitHub仓库会影响我的fork吗?
A: 是的,删除您的仓库将同时删除所有从该仓库派生的fork。
Q2: 删除仓库后,我是否还可以访问原始代码?
A: 一旦您删除了仓库,您将无法再访问任何文件或代码,建议在删除之前做好备份。
Q3: 如何恢复已删除的仓库?
A: 不幸的是,GitHub不提供恢复已删除仓库的功能,删除后将无法恢复。
Q4: 我是否可以删除别人的仓库?
A: 只有在您是该仓库的所有者或具有删除权限的情况下,您才能删除仓库。
Q5: 如果我不小心删除了仓库,该怎么办?
A: 删除是不可逆的,因此请确保在删除前仔细考虑和备份数据。
结论
了解如何在GitHub中删除仓库是一项重要的技能,这不仅可以帮助您管理您的项目,也能维护您的代码库的整洁性。在执行删除操作时,请务必小心,并确保您已备份必要的数据。希望本指南能够帮助您顺利完成操作!
正文完